In this performance comparison, the Oppo F31 Pro Plus with its Qualcomm Snapdragon 7 Gen 3 (4nm) performs better than the Motorola Razr 60 with the MediaTek Dimensity 7400 (4nm), thanks to superior chipset efficiency.
Motorola Razr 60 launched with Android 15 and will receive updates until Android 18, whereas Oppo F31 Pro Plus launched with Android 15 and will get Android 17. Motorola Razr 60 will get security updates until 2029 (approx. 4 years), while Oppo F31 Pro Plus is supported till 2028.
Both Motorola Razr 60 and Oppo F31 Pro Plus feature AMOLED displays, offering vibrant colors and deeper blacks. Both smartphones offer the same 120 Hz refresh rate. Motorola Razr 60 also boasts a brighter screen with 3000 nits of peak brightness, enhancing outdoor visibility. Notably, Oppo F31 Pro Plus offers a higher screen resolution, resulting in sharper visuals and more detailed content.
Oppo F31 Pro Plus features a larger 7000 mAh battery, potentially delivering better battery life. Oppo F31 Pro Plus also supports faster wired charging at 80W, compared to 30W on Motorola Razr 60. Motorola Razr 60 supports wireless charging at 15W, while Oppo F31 Pro Plus does not support wireless charging.
Oppo F31 Pro Plus offers better protection against water and dust with an IP69 rating.
